The Technological Foundation of Anonymity

The technological advancements that underpin anonymous gaming are multifaceted and constantly evolving. C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in and Ethereum, play a significant role, allowing for transactions without revealing personal banking information. These digital currencies offer a layer of pseudonymity, where transactions are linked to a wallet address rather than an individual's identity. Furthermore, advanced encryption technologies protect communication between players and the gaming platform, safeguarding sensitive data from potential interception. The use of VPNs (Virtual Private Networks) and Tor (The Onion Router) further enhances anonymity by masking IP addresses and routing internet traffic through a series of encrypted nodes.

However, it’s important to recognize that no system is entirely foolproof. While these technologies significantly enhance privacy, users must also exercise caution and adopt best practices to protect their identities. This includes using str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ication, and being wary of phishing attempts. The responsibility for maintaining anonymity ultimately lies with the individual player, and a proactive approach to security is essential. Platforms dedicated to anonymity continuously refine their security protocols to stay ahead of emerging threats, but users must remain vigilant and informed.

Protecting Your Identity While Gaming Online

Even when utilizing an incognito casino platform, proactive measures to protect your identity are crucial. While the platform may offer a level of anonymity, it's important to remember that no system is entirely impenetrable. One foundational step is to use a strong, unique password for your account. Avoid using easily guessable passwords, such as birthdays or common words. Instead, opt for a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. Enable two-factor authentication whenever available, adding an extra layer of security to your account. This requires a secondary verification method, such as a code sent to your mobile phone, in addition to your password.

Consider using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to mask your IP address and encrypt your internet traffic. This makes it more difficult for third parties to track your online activity. Be cautious about sharing personal information, even with the gaming platform. Only provide the information that is absolutely necessary. Avoid clicking on suspicious links or opening attachments from unknown sources, as these could be phishing attempts designed to steal your credentials. Regularly review the platform's privacy policy to understand how your data is being collected and used. Stay informed about the latest security threats and best practices for protecting your online identity.

Best Practices for Secure Transactions

When making deposits or withdrawals, prioritize secure transaction methods. Cryptocurrencies are generally considered a more private option, as they don't require you to share your banking details. If using a credit card or other traditional payment method, ensure that the platform utilizes secure payment gateways and encryption protocols. Avoid using public Wi-Fi networks for financial transactions, as these networks are often insecure. Instead, use a secure, private Wi-Fi connection. Regularly monitor your bank account and credit card statements for any unauthorized activity. Report any suspicious transactions to your financial institution immediately. It is wise to set spending limits to better control your finances.
